7-Ingredient Banana Peanut Butter Oat Bars: An Incredible Ultimate Recipe


  • Author: Nora Bennett
  • Total Time: 40 minutes

Ingredients

– 2 ripe bananas
– 1 cup rolled oats
– ½ cup peanut butter
– ¼ cup honey or maple syrup (for sweetness)
– 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
– ½ teaspoon cinnamon (optional)
– ¼ teaspoon salt


Instructions

Making 7-Ingredient Banana Peanut Butter Oat Bars is simple. Follow these steps for a successful batch every time:

1. Preheat the Oven: Begin by preheating your oven to 350°F (175°C). This is crucial for even baking.
2. Mash the Bananas: In a large mixing bowl, mash the ripe bananas until smooth using a fork or a potato masher. Aim for a creamy texture with minimal lumps.
3. Mix Wet Ingredients: Add the peanut butter, honey or maple syrup, and vanilla extract to the mashed bananas. Stir until the mixture is combined and smooth.
4. Combine Dry Ingredients: In a separate bowl, mix the rolled oats, cinnamon (if using), and salt.
5. Combine Mixtures: Gradually add the dry ingredients to the wet mixture. Stir until fully incorporated, ensuring there are no dry patches.
6. Prepare Baking Dish: Line an 8×8-inch baking dish with parchment paper for easy removal. This step helps prevent sticking.
7. Transfer Mixture: Pour the mixture into the prepared baking dish. Use a spatula to spread it out evenly.
8. Bake: Place in the preheated oven and bake for 20-25 minutes, or until the edges are golden brown and a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ean.
9. Cool: Once baked, remove from the oven and allow to cool in the pan for about 10-15 minutes. Then transfer to a wire rack to cool completely.
10. Cut and Serve: Once cooled, cut into bars of your desired size.

By following these steps, you’ll have perfectly delicious bars ready to enjoy!
